oxid-esales / developer-tools
该组件包含开发者工具。
v2.4.0
2024-03-15 13:50 UTC
- dev-master
- dev-b-8.0.x
- v2.4.0
- v2.3.1
- v2.3.0
- v2.2.0
- v2.1.0
- v2.0.0
- v1.1.0
- v1.0.1
- v1.0.0
- dev-b-8.0.x-setup-command-OXDEV-8656
- dev-b-8.0.x-no-config-inc-OXDEV-7248
- dev-b-7.2.x
- dev-b-7.1.x
- dev-b-7.1.x-investigate
- dev-b-7.0.x-new_dev_recipes-OXDEV-7845
- dev-b-7.0.x
- dev-b-7.0.x-gha-psr
- dev-b-8.0.x-dt-gha
- dev-b-7.0.x-dt-gha-php-cs
- dev-detached
- dev-b-6.5.x
- dev-b-6.5.x-update-github-action-OXDEV-6742
- dev-b-6.2.x
This package is auto-updated.
Last update: 2024-09-13 10:58:50 UTC
README
此组件包含OXID eShop的附加开发者工具。
安装
运行以下命令以安装组件
composer require oxid-esales/developer-tools
用法
重置项目配置
要将项目配置重置为其初始状态,请执行以下操作
bin/oe-console oe:module:reset-configurations
重置/安装商店数据库
要重置数据库到其初始状态,请运行以下命令
bin/oe-console oe:database:reset --db-host DB-HOST --db-port DB-PORT --db-name DB-NAME --db-user DB-USER --db-password DB-PASSWORD [--force]
哪个
- <db-host> is the database host
- <db-port> is the database port
- <db-name> is the database name
- <db-user> is the database username
- <db-password> is the database password
- [<force>] (optional) if set runs the command without confirmation
示例
bin/oe-console oe:database:reset --db-host=localhost --db-port=3306 --db-name=test --db-user=test --db-password=test
注意:运行此命令后,您所有数据将从数据库中删除。请勿在生产系统上运行此命令。
激活主题
要激活主题,请执行以下操作
bin/oe-console oe:theme:activate THEME-ID
如何为开发安装组件?
检出组件到OXID eShop source
目录之外
git clone https://github.com/OXID-eSales/developer-tools.git
运行composer install命令
cd developer-tools
composer install
将依赖项添加到OXID eShop composer.json
文件中
composer config repositories.oxid-esales/developer-tools path developer-tools
composer require --dev oxid-esales/developer-tools:*
如何运行测试?
要运行组件的测试,请定义OXID eShop引导文件
vendor/bin/phpunit --bootstrap=../source/bootstrap.php tests/
许可证
有关许可证详细信息,请参阅LICENSE 文件。